Problem

The drilling industry lacks standardized well prognosis documents, making it difficult to automate the identification and execution of action items, leading to inefficiencies in project planning and execution.

Innovation Solution

A computer-based project plan execution system that includes an interface engine, an action item development engine, and a sensor engine to analyze and control well drilling operations by identifying and executing action items based on a well prognosis document.

AI summary

A prog analysis and execution system and method. The system includes a computer control system, an interface engine in communication with the computer control system, the interface engine being configured to receive prog information, and an action item development engine in communication with the control system, the action item development engine being configured to analyze received prog information and to determine corresponding action items. The system further includes a sensor engine in communication with the computer control system, the sensor engine being configured to receive input from at least one sensor for use in controlling a well drilling operation, and an operational equipment engine in communication with the computer control system, the operational equipment engine being configured to receive input from the computer control system and to control the well drilling operation in accordance with the determined action items in the prog.
